New Card Auctions and Offseason XP Changes:

During the approaching MLB offseason, Sorare, the innovative fantasy sports platform, plans to usher in a paradigm shift with new card auctions. The development team guarantees that users will always have at least 24 player cards available. Sorare will no longer enable cards to accumulate XP during the offseason, a deliberate departure from the previous season's approach.

What is the significance of the XP Change? The decision to discontinue offseason XP growth is founded in the mid-season debut and the need for a more strategic user experience, according to developers.

Pro Cards' Fate and Special Edition Cards:

Season 3 sees the retirement of old Common Cards, but Pro Cards, including Limited, Rare, Super Rare, and Unique NFT assets, will remain in users' collections. During the offseason, "Award Edition Cards" will be released to recognize MLB end-of-season award winners and contributors to managers' prizes.

Sorare stresses Pro Card value retention and continuity in user collections, giving stability and continuing delight for dedicated players.

Collection Game Evolution:

Season 3 sees a significant change to the Collection Game, with collections now categorized by team, season, and scarcity. Every card will be assigned a Collection Score based on characteristics like ownership status, inactivity, special edition design, being the first owner, and having a serial number that matches the player's jersey number.
